MySQL数据库权限工作原理详解

需积分: 19 5 下载量 111 浏览量 更新于2024-08-13 收藏 518KB PPT 举报
"这篇资料主要介绍了MySQL数据库的权限工作原理,同时也概述了数据库的基本概念,包括数据、数据库、数据库管理系统和数据库系统。资料通过一系列条目详细解释了数据的定义、种类、特点,以及数据库的定义和类型。此外,还提到了数据库的组织形式,如档案柜比喻的数据库结构,以及不同类型的数据库,如纯文本数据库和关系数据库的差异。" 在MySQL数据库中,权限系统是确保数据安全和控制用户访问的关键部分。权限工作原理涉及用户账户的创建、角色的设定以及对特定数据库或表的操作授权。管理员可以分配不同的权限,如SELECT、INSERT、UPDATE、DELETE等,允许或禁止用户执行特定操作。默认情况下,新创建的用户可能没有任何权限,需要管理员根据需求进行授权。 数据库导论部分介绍了基本概念,数据是数据库中存储的基本对象,它可以是文字、图形、图像、声音等多种形式,并且具有不可分割的语义特性。数据库是一个有组织、可共享的大量数据集合,用于存储和处理数据。数据库管理系统(DBMS)是管理和控制数据库的软件,而数据库系统(DBS)则包括DBMS和数据库以及相关的硬件、软件和人员。 数据库的类型包括纯文本数据库和关系数据库。纯文本数据库适用于小型应用,但不支持随机访问和复杂的查询操作。相比之下,关系数据库采用关系模型,数据结构简单,支持多用户访问和复杂查询,如SQL语句,是目前广泛应用的数据库类型。 在实际应用中,数据库被组织成表格,每个表格包含多个记录,记录由字段组成。用户可以通过查询语言(如SQL)来检索、更新或删除数据。权限设置确保只有具备相应权限的用户才能执行这些操作,从而保护数据的安全性和完整性。 总结来说,这篇资料提供了MySQL数据库权限工作的基础理解,同时也深入浅出地讲解了数据库的基本概念,包括数据的性质、数据库的定义和分类,以及数据库在实际操作中的组织形式。对于想要了解MySQL数据库管理和权限控制的读者,这些内容提供了很好的入门指导。